Understanding the Odds

A common myth surrounding gambling is the belief that players can consistently beat the odds. Many believe that past outcomes can influence future results, leading to the misconception that certain games can be manipulated. In reality, games like slots and roulette operate under strict probabilities and randomness, meaning every spin or hand is independent of the last. This myth can lead to reckless gambling behavior, as individuals may chase losses or alter their strategies based on faulty assumptions. Understanding that each game round is a separate event helps to establish a more responsible approach to gambling.

The House Always Wins

Another prevalent notion is that the house always wins and players have no chance of success. While it’s true that casinos are designed to generate profit, this does not mean that players cannot win. Many games offer significant payouts, and smart strategy can increase a player’s chances of winning. Skill-based games like poker or blackjack allow for a level of player influence over the outcome.

It’s important to recognize that while the odds may be against players, success is still possible. The key lies in understanding the game rules and employing effective strategies to improve one’s chances.

Gambling as an Easy Way to Make Money

Many newcomers enter the gambling world with the misconception that it is an easy way to earn money. This myth can lead to significant financial losses, as individuals often overlook the risks involved. G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ment rather than a reliable income source.

Engaging in gambling requires discipline and an understanding of one’s financial limits. Recognizing that the thrill of betting is not synonymous with guaranteed profits is essential for maintaining a healthy relationship with gambling.

The Impact of Superstitions

Superstitions play a major role in the gambling culture, with many believing that certain rituals or lucky charms can influence outcomes. From wearing lucky socks to avoiding certain numbers, these beliefs can skew players’ perception of the game’s inherent randomness. While it can be fun to participate in such traditions, it’s crucial to understand that they do not impact the odds.

Maintaining a rational mindset and focusing on strategies rather than luck can lead to a more enjoyable gambling experience. Understanding the randomness of games can help demystify these superstitions and encourage responsible gambling practices.
